Recycles donated clothing, furniture, household goods, books, and other items by offering them for purchase. Proceeds benefit the community by offering individuals with barriers work training and employment opportunities. Goodwill has a clothing voucher program. Must be referred from a non-profit or government program. In Sioux Falls, DSS does not have vouchers for Goodwill. Programs offering vouchers are: Sioux Falls Housing, Community Outreach, Children's Home Society, Heartland House - Inter Lakes Community Action Program (ICAP), Southeastern Directions for Life Community Support Services, Glory House, Department of Labor, ICAP Early Head Start, Sioux Falls VA, Compass Center, Minnehaha Drug Court, Goodwill's Mission department (only available after all other agencies have exhausted their supplies.)

Builds homes for people in need: Habitat for Humanity builds houses in partnership with volunteers and people in need and then sells the homes to those people in need, known as partner families. Partner families are selected by Habitat based on: their need for housing; their willingness to partner with Habitat; and the ability to pay a 0% interest mortgage.
Assists in restoration on exterior of existing homes for people in need: Volunteers (including youth groups), are organized and recruited by Hub Area Habitat for Humanity to assist with the following projects for income eligible homeowners including: Exterior painting or siding, Minor exterior home repairs, or Yard work including: weeding, trimming shrubbery, raking leaves (yard rehabilitation, not lawn mowing). This does not include tree trimming of taking down a tree.
Help Build It Center: a store where items can be donated and purchased at discounted prices. Items consist of: light fixtures, bathroom fixtures, furniture, appliances, carpet, wood and tile flooring, windows and doors, paints and stains and other miscellaneous home goods.
